Published Date - 27 February 2022, 10:23 PM
Hyderabad: We have usually seen film celebrities and leading politicians doing ‘ask me anything sessions’ on social media platforms. But breaking that trend, this time, senior IAS officer Smita Sabharwal took time to interact with the netizens on Twitter with #askSS.
The CMO Secretary posted: “So we never got around to the #askSS… but here’s an ask from me to you all! I want my timeline to be useful, timely, and more worth your while. So let me know what I can do better?!”
Soon after, several netizens quizzed Smita, who has completed 20 years as a civil servant, about her struggles at the workplace and how inspiring she has been to several civil aspirants.
While a few asked Smita Sabharwal to write a snippet of her life story and experiences being a civil servant every week to inspire Twitter users, some even asked her to share about her recent films watched, favourite Hyderabadi food and also her favourite novel.
Some netizens made suggestions too. “Madam, a small request from me. Please give the duty of planting trees to the students, make it a part of their education and allot some marks to it. By this, they will get the awareness on protection of environment and plants. By this program, money spent on this program is saved in huge amounts. I humbly request you to implement so,” shared a user. Smita quickly replied saying: “Nice suggestion. Let’s see if we can make it a mandate soon.”
Another Twitter user quizzed about one initiative that gave the senior officer lots of satisfaction and Smita Sabharwal responded saying: Maternal and Child Health initiative- Amma Lalana ( done during district tenure).
Some also asked her about her sari collection, to which Smita responded saying most of them are handloom and are of her mother’s.
Towards the end, when Smita Sabharwal was quizzed, If given a chance, will she choose to be an IAS again to which she responded with enthusiasm: “Every single time ! Its a great platform to deliver work that impacts people.”
